D.: Zwei Tabellen nebeneinander - andere Darstellung im IE

Hallo!

Ich habe zwei Tabellen, die ich nebeneinander darstellen möchte. Da die Tabellen in einem Abstand von genau 10px zueinander stehen sollen, habe ich einfach eine weitere (unsichtbare) Tabelle zwischen den beiden eingefügt, die 10px breit ist.

Der (wesentliche, komprimierte) Code:

<table border=0 class="topbox" cellpadding="5px" align="left">
<tr>
<td>
---CONTENT---
</td>
</tr></table>

<table border=0 class="fillbox">
<tr><td>&nbsp;</td></tr>
</table>

<table border=0 class="topbox" cellpadding="5px">
<tr>
<td>
---CONTENT2---
</td>
</tr></table>

CSS:

table.topbox { border-width:1px; border-style:dashed; border-color:#000000; border-collapse:collapse; border-spacing:3px; width:340px; }
table.fillbox { width:10px; float:left; }

Im Firefox und Safari werden die Boxen richtig dargestellt. Im IE ist die eine, ganz rechte Tabelle um eine Zeile (quasi ein <br>) nach unten verschoben, d.h. beginnt eine Zeile später und ist eine Zeile später zu Ende.

Ich kann weder ein <br> noch einen anderen Grund für diese Darstellung finden. Kann mir jemand helfen?

Danke!

  1. Hi,

    Ich habe zwei Tabellen, die ich nebeneinander darstellen möchte. Da die Tabellen in einem Abstand von genau 10px zueinander stehen sollen, habe ich einfach eine weitere (unsichtbare) Tabelle zwischen den beiden eingefügt, die 10px breit ist.

    Der erste April ist vorbei, also lass' doch bitte solche dreckigen Scherze ...

    Nutze margin fuer Abstaende, Punkt.

    MfG ChrisB